Nelson’s Prediction Chest. Columbus: Nelson Enterprises, ca. 1945. Brass-bound humpbacked chest in which a prediction of future events is locked. During the magician’s performance, the chest is unlocked by a member of the audience who removes a brass tube from inside. It contains the prediction which is read aloud and proven to be accurate. 7 ? x 14 x 9 ½". With two keys and brass pellet, the latter not available in other Nelson chests. Said to be one of twelve chests of this size made for and sold by Nelson. Said to be the chest used by John Booth to predict a newspaper headline, as reported by the St. Louis Star-Times and the Globe Democrat and later published in the July, 1946 issue of The Linking Ring.
